The Swampscott girls soccer team fought to a 2-2 tie Saturday at Hoosac Valley High School.
Swampscott scored in the sixth minute when Mackenzie Kearney, assisted by Sydney Clark, gave the Blue a quick 1-0 lead. However, Hoosac tied it in the 48th minute on a goal by Skylar Case, assisted by Alle Mendel.
Swampscott took what looked to be a secure 2-1 lead in the 75th minute when Haley Bernhardt scored with an assist by Grace DiGrande. However, Hoosac Valley responded just two minutes later, with Shaleigh Levesque doing the honors.
Coach Alvi Ibanez said Sarah Tribendis had a tremendous game at holding midfield while Sydney Clark was solid as an offensive midfielder. As an outside midfielder, Alison Tribendis showed great stamina while making offensive runs and recovery runs, he said.
Peabody 1, Marblehead 0
At Peabody, Emily Nelson got the goal, with an assist from Jillian Arigo, as Peabody raised its record to 4-2-2 (2-1-1 in the Northeastern Conference).
Playing well for the Tanners were Colleen Crotty, Jordan Collins, Megan Edmonds, Catherine Manning and Aja Alimonte. Keeper Jordan Muse had eight saves.
Hannah Garthe had 14 saves for the Magicians.
